What to Consider When Choosing a Robot Vacuum:

Choosing the ideal robot vacuum includes more than simply choosing the flashiest design. Carefully consider the following elements to guarantee you choose a gadget that genuinely meets your needs and offers worth:
Budget: Robot vacuums range in rate from under ₤ 200 to over ₤ 1000. Determine your budget upfront to limit your choices. Keep in mind that greater cost points frequently correlate with more advanced functions like smarter navigation, more powerful suction, and self-emptying capabilities.Floor Types: Consider the dominant floor key ins your home. Houses with mainly tough floors may benefit from designs with mopping functions, while homes with thick carpets require strong suction power and brush roll styles crafted for carpet cleaning. Some designs are versatile and perform well on both hard floors and carpets.Pet Ownership: Pet hair is a common cleaning obstacle. If you have family pets, look for robot vacuums specifically created to deal with pet hair. These frequently include tangle-free brush rolls, robust suction, and reliable filtering systems to catch allergens.Home Size and Layout: Larger homes or those with multiple levels may demand robot vacuums with longer battery life and smart mapping functions to ensure total cleaning protection. Homes with complex layouts and many barriers will gain from innovative navigation systems.Smart Features and Connectivity: Do you want app control, scheduling, virtual walls, or voice assistant integration? Smart features improve convenience and customisation however frequently come at a greater price.Navigation and Mapping:Random Bounce: Basic designs often use random bounce navigation, which is less efficient however can still clean up efficiently in smaller sized areas.Systematic Navigation (LiDAR or Camera-based): More innovative designs utilize LiDAR (Light Detection and Ranging) or camera-based systems to map your home and browse methodically. This results in more effective cleaning, room-by-room cleaning, and the capability to set virtual borders.Suction Power: Measured in Pascals (Pa), suction power figures out how effectively a robot vacuum gets dirt and debris. Higher suction is normally better, especially for carpets and pet hair.Battery Life and Charging: Battery life determines for how long the robot vacuum can work on a single charge. Consider the size of your home and select a model with enough battery life to clean it effectively. Automatic recharging is a basic feature, where the robot go back to its dock when the battery is low.Self-Emptying Feature: Some premium models feature self-emptying bases. These bases instantly draw the dust and debris from the robot's dustbin into a larger, disposable bag, considerably minimizing the frequency of manual dustbin emptying and improving benefit.Sound Level: Robot vacuums differ in noise output. If sound sensitivity is an issue, try to find models marketed as peaceful operating.

Tips for Getting the Most Out of Your Robot Vacuum:

To ensure your robot vacuum runs efficiently and effectively for many years to come, think about these handy tips:
Prepare Your Home: Before running your robot vacuum, declutter your floors by removing loose cables, small toys, and other barriers that could impede its navigation or get tangled in the brushes.Routine Maintenance: Empty the dustbin routinely (or less often with self-emptying models), tidy the brushes and filters as advised by the maker, and inspect for any blockages or use and tear.Schedule Cleaning Sessions: Utilize the scheduling feature to set your robot vacuum to clean automatically at practical times, such as when you are at work or asleep.Use Virtual Boundaries: If your robot vacuum has virtual wall or zoned cleaning functions, utilize them to prevent the robot from getting in particular areas or to target cleaning to particular spaces.Display Performance: Occasionally observe your robot vacuum cleaners vacuum in action to guarantee it is cleaning efficiently and navigating properly. Resolve any concerns promptly.Keep Software Updated: If your robot vacuum has app connectivity, guarantee you keep the firmware and app updated to benefit from the newest functions and efficiency enhancements.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s):
Q: Are robot vacuums worth the financial investment?A: For busy individuals and those looking for to lower their cleaning workload, robot vacuums can be a beneficial financial investment. They automate a tiresome task and can preserve a regularly cleaner home.Q: Can robot vacuums change conventional vacuums completely?A: good robot vacuum cleaner vacuums are outstanding for regular upkeep cleaning but may not totally replace conventional vacuums for deep cleaning jobs, corner cleaning, or cleaning upholstery and stairs. Numerous users discover they supplement their robot vacuum with a conventional vacuum for more extensive cleaning.Q: How frequently should I run my robot vacuum?A: Daily cleaning is ideal for preserving a regularly tidy home, especially in families with animals or children. However, you can change the frequency based on your needs and home traffic.Q: Do robot vacuums deal with carpets and carpets?A: Yes, many robot vacuums are developed to deal with both hard floorings and carpets. Search for designs with strong suction and brush rolls developed for carpet cleaning performance.Q: How long do robot vacuums generally last?A: With correct maintenance, a great quality robot vacuum can last for numerous years, typically 3-5 years or longer depending upon use and brand name.Q: Are robot vacuums loud?A: Robot vacuums typically produce less noise than traditional vacuums, however noise levels vary between designs. Some models are specifically developed for quieter operation.Q: What is the distinction in between LiDAR and camera-based navigation?A: LiDAR (Light Detection and Ranging) uses lasers to develop a comprehensive map of your home, offering accurate navigation and effective cleaning courses. Camera-based systems utilize visual details to browse. LiDAR is usually considered more precise and reliable in low-light conditions.
